Description
Celebrate with these festive Star Spangled Cookies, perfect for Independence Day or any patriotic occasion. These delicious cookies are decorated with vibrant red, white, and blue icing, making them a delightful treat for everyone.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 3/4 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1 cup unsalted butter
- 1 1/2 cups granulated sugar
- 1 large egg
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- as needed red food coloring
- as needed blue food coloring
- for decorating royal icing
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
- In a bowl, whisk together flour, baking powder, and salt; set aside.
- In a large bowl, cream together the softened butter and sugar until light and fluffy.
- Beat in the egg and vanilla extract until well combined.
-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et mixture, mixing until just combined.
- Divide the dough into three equal portions. Leave one portion as is for the white cookies.
- Color one portion with red food coloring and the other with blue food coloring, mixing until the colors are well incorporated.
- Roll out each colored dough between sheets of parchment paper to about 1/4 inch thick. Cut out star shapes using a cookie cutter.
- Place the cookies on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per and bake for 8-10 minutes or until the edges are lightly golden.
- Allow cookies to cool completely on wire racks before decorating.
- Decorate the cookies with royal icing in red, white, and blue designs.
Notes
- If the dough is too soft to roll out, chill it in the refrigerator for 30 minutes.
- For a fun twist, add sprinkles on top of the icing before it sets.
- Store decorated cookies in an airtight container at room temperature for up to a week.
